I have now also, changed the event type from Object to Event, in the
cairngormEventDispatcher call. So the code looks like this:

public function updateSelectedShip( event : Event ) : void 
{
        selectedShip = event.target.selectedShip;
        CairngormEventDispatcher.getInstance().dispatchEvent( new
 CairngormEvent( SELECT_EVENT ) );
                }


Also I debugged nearly every line of code trying to discern whats
going on, and in the event.target I found an attribute called
selectedItem, which I did not create. So I dont know if thats being
setup somehow automatically or not. 

If I set in the select event "model.selectedShip =
event.target.selectedItem" 

the thing changes the grids selectedShip shipVO object to what the new
selection is. 

However the MODEL is still not being updated. I dont get it. 

I can update the workflow state on the model by clicking buttons, I
can adjust the various arrays that are being stored on the model, but
I cannot set this one shipVO object equal to what is currently
selected in the grid.

> I have looked over the CMORGCHART, CGLOGIN, and CGSTORE examples, and
> I guess I am stupid cause I still cannot get model variables to update. 
> 
> What I am trying to do is simple. 
> 
> I have a grid, that contains an array collection of ship objects. 
> 
> I have a shipdetails screen. What I want to do is display the details
> of the ship object selected in the ship grid, on the ship details pane. 
> 
> The view layout is simple, I have a Vbox, called ShipBody, it
> contains, both the ShipGrid, and ShipDetails components. 
> 
> On my model, I have an arrayCollection called ships. It is my returned
> value from the service I call. The Ship Grid object uses that variable
> on model, for its dataprovider. 
> 
> On my ShipDetails component I have a variable called shipSelected
> which is of type ShipVO, the same type of variable is set on the grid
> component of the same object type. Then from the details component
> each of the text fields are set to shipSelected.attrbuteName. 
> 
> When I call the ShipDetails component from the ShipBody component, I
> tell it to set the shipSelected variable to the model.selectedShip.
> 
> However the problem comes in from the grids perspective. I cannot seem
> to get the grid to actually change the model.selectedShip attribute.
> So if ship number one is intially set on the result handler from the
> service, no matter that the change event seems to fire from the
> ShipGrid component, it never updates the model. 
> 
> Here is the code:
>
